Obverse description Frontal bust of a bishop or patriarch in high relief, wearing a mitre and ecclesiastical vestments with stylized drapery folds rendered in the Romanesque manner. The figure holds a crozier or staff in the right hand, with the left hand raised or extended, set within a beaded or rope inner border. A Latin legend, partially legible due to the irregular flan, surrounds the central device in the field.

Reverse description Two facing busts in profile confronting one another at center, separated by a cluster of three pellets; above, a multi-pointed star flanked by two small crosses. The busts, rendered in a stylized Romanesque fashion, rest on a horizontal ground line with a decorative necklace or collar indicated below each. The entire device is enclosed within a beaded inner border with a further outer rope or cable border following the irregular coin flan.
